IGG expands Busega–Mpigi Expressway probe after fresh leads emerge
5
SHARES
59
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on LinkedinShare on WhatAappShare by Email

The Inspector General of Government (IGG), Lady Justice Naluzze Aisha Batala, has expanded investigations into the stalled Busega–Mpigi Expressway project after an onsite inspection uncovered fresh leads that could deepen the probe into alleged financial irregularities.

During the inspection on Monday, the IGG said the visit had revealed new areas of inquiry that would strengthen ongoing investigations into the management and utilisation of funds allocated to the 23-kilometre expressway and its 20 kilometres of access roads.

“We came to establish what exists on the ground, including the basis for the redesign of the project. The findings from this inspection will provide critical evidence to support our ongoing investigations. We are also keen to understand the factors that led to the project’s cost escalating from shs600 billion to shs1.3 trillion, so that we can determine whether the increase was justified and in the public interest,” Lady Justice Naluzze said.

She explained that the inspection, conducted alongside technical officials from the Ministry of Works and Transport, had exposed new areas that would enable investigators to widen the scope of the inquiry and establish the circumstances surrounding the delayed project.

The Inspectorate of Government is investigating whether the redesign, cost escalation and implementation of the project were conducted in accordance with the law, and whether any public officials manipulated the process for personal benefit.

The inspection is also part of wider efforts to identify the challenges that have stalled one of Uganda’s major road infrastructure projects while ensuring accountability and value for public resources.

The latest developments follow the Ministry of Works and Transport’s implementation of an IGG directive issued on July 1, 2026, suspending two engineers — Edwin Raymond Kiyaga and Dickens Ahimbisibwe — over allegations of mismanagement of funds meant for the expressway project.

Lady Justice Naluzze was accompanied by the Director of Project, Risk Monitoring and Control, Annet Twine; Director of Legal Affairs, Hilda Talibba; Assistant Director of Public Relations, Hajjat Munira Ali; and other officials from the Inspectorate of Government.

The IGG’s office said investigations are ongoing and that any individuals found responsible for financial impropriety or abuse of office will be held accountable in accordance with the law.

The Busega–Mpigi Expressway is a key section of the Northern Transport Corridor, linking Kenya, Uganda and the Democratic Republic of Congo. The project was launched in 2014 but has faced years of delays.

Following challenges with the original contractor, China Communications Construction Company (CCCC), the government replaced the firm with a joint venture between China Civil Engineering Construction Corporation (CCECC) and China Railway 19th Bureau Group.

The project is funded by the African Development Bank and the African Development Fund, which committed US$151 million for construction, while the government provided US$41 million for land compensation.

Construction officially began in May 2020 but was delayed by land compensation disputes and disruptions caused by the COVID-19 pandemic. In November 2025, the African Development Bank approved an additional Shs891.2 billion (€217 million) to support completion of the long-delayed expressway.
